Accenture Video Analytics: Transforming Data into Actionable Insights

There’s something quietly fascinating about how video analytics technology connects so many fields — from retail and security to healthcare and transportation. Accenture, a global leader in professional services and consulting, leverages advanced video analytics solutions to help organizations unlock the power hidden in video data. By converting raw video feeds into actionable insights, Accenture empowers businesses to make smarter decisions, improve operational efficiency, and enhance customer experiences.

What Is Video Analytics?

Video analytics refers to the process of using artificial intelligence (AI), machine learning, and computer vision technologies to automatically analyze video footage. This analysis can detect, classify, and track objects and behaviors in real-time or from recorded footage. The insights derived can then be used for various purposes, such as security monitoring, customer behavior analysis, traffic management, and more.

Accenture’s Approach to Video Analytics

Accenture combines its deep industry expertise with cutting-edge technology platforms to design and implement video analytics solutions tailored to diverse client needs. Their approach typically involves integrating video analytics with cloud computing, Internet of Things (IoT), and big data platforms to create scalable, secure, and intelligent systems.

One key aspect of Accenture’s video analytics is leveraging AI models that can be trained on specific use cases, enabling high accuracy in object recognition and anomaly detection. This customization ensures that clients receive relevant insights that directly impact their operational goals.

Applications Across Industries

Retail: Accenture’s video analytics solutions help retailers analyze foot traffic, monitor shelf inventory, and understand shopper behaviors. This data enables optimized store layouts, personalized marketing, and loss prevention.

Security and Surveillance: Enhancing security operations is a priority for many organizations. Accenture’s solutions can detect suspicious activities, identify unauthorized access, and trigger alerts in real-time, improving responsiveness and safety.

Transportation: From traffic flow analysis to monitoring public transit, video analytics supports smarter urban mobility solutions. Accenture aids cities and transport authorities in reducing congestion and improving passenger experiences.

Healthcare: In healthcare settings, video analytics can monitor patient movements, ensure compliance with hygiene protocols, and assist in asset tracking, contributing to safer and more efficient care environments.

Challenges and Considerations

While the benefits are compelling, implementing video analytics also entails addressing privacy concerns, data security, and compliance with regulations such as GDPR. Accenture emphasizes responsible AI practices and works closely with clients to ensure ethical and legal standards are maintained.

Moreover, the quality of video inputs and the robustness of AI models are critical to achieving reliable analytics, necessitating ongoing system tuning and maintenance.

Context: The Rise of Video Data and Analytics

The exponential increase in video data generated by surveillance cameras, mobile devices, and IoT sensors has created both opportunities and challenges. Traditional methods of video monitoring—largely reliant on human operators—are no longer sufficient to manage the volume or derive actionable insights. Accenture recognized this gap and invested heavily in artificial intelligence and cloud infrastructure to automate video analysis, enabling real-time intelligence at scale.

Technological Foundations and Methodologies

Accenture’s video analytics solutions leverage advanced computer vision algorithms, deep learning frameworks, and edge computing to process video streams efficiently. By combining AI with cloud-based platforms, they offer scalable analytics that can adapt to diverse client environments, from retail stores to smart cities.

A notable feature is the integration of multi-modal data streams, where video analytics is combined with other sensor data to provide richer context and more accurate insights.

Cause: Business and Societal Drivers

The push toward video analytics stems from several intertwined factors. Businesses seek to optimize operations, enhance security, and improve customer engagement through data-driven strategies. Concurrently, societal demands for safer public spaces and efficient infrastructure spur investments in intelligent surveillance and traffic management systems.

Accenture’s role is to translate these demands into actionable technology solutions that balance technical feasibility with ethical considerations, including privacy protection and bias mitigation.

Consequences: Transformations and Challenges

Accenture’s deployment of video analytics has led to significant transformations. Retailers report increased sales and reduced shrinkage; urban planners leverage traffic analytics to alleviate congestion; security agencies benefit from proactive threat detection.

However, these advances also raise critical challenges. Privacy concerns loom large, necessitating strict compliance with data protection laws and transparent AI governance. Furthermore, reliance on automated systems requires continuous oversight to prevent errors and ensure fairness.

Ethical and Regulatory Dimensions

Accenture actively engages with stakeholders to address ethical questions surrounding video analytics. This includes implementing privacy-by-design principles, anonymizing personal data where possible, and ensuring AI models are explainable and auditable.

Regulatory landscapes such as the European GDPR impose stringent requirements on data handling, influencing how Accenture architects its solutions globally.
